Man Killed in Pursuit by Montgomery County Sheriff’s Department Identified by Missouri Highway Patrol
The Missouri Highway Patrol is identifying a man who was killed yesterday (Thursday) during a pursuit by the Montgomery County Sheriff’s Department.
According to the crash report the Montgomery County Sheriff’s Office was pursuing a motorcycle that was driven by 29-year-old Kyle Barnes of Truxton.
Deputies were chasing the motorcycle when a truck tried to make a left turn.
The motorcycle crashed into the side of the truck, which was being driven by a 16-year-old.
Barnes was ejected from his motorcycle and pronounced dead.
The crash happened just before 4pm on Highway 19 near Industrial Park Drive.
